Additional Liability Under Respondeat Superior

Abstract

A recent Colorado supreme court case held that in a civil action when an employer admits liability for the tortious actions of its employee, the plaintiff cannot assert additional claims against the employer arising out of the same incident. The bill allows a plaintiff to bring such claims against an employer. (Note: This summary applies to this bill as introduced.)
